site stats

How to reverse linked list in javascript

WebThere's a right and a wrong way to reverse an array in JavaScript. It's a subtle difference. But in the second example, we spread the original array into a… 14 comments on LinkedIn Web24 apr. 2014 · const reverse = (head) => { if (!head !head.next) { return head; } let temp = reverse(head.next); head.next.next = head; head.next = undefined; return …

REVERSE A SINGLY LINKED LIST USING JAVASCRIPT

Web30 jun. 2024 · For reversal, no manipulation is done in the links that connect the node of the linked list. Only the data values are changed. To understand this more clearly, take a look at the following diagram. The numbers in red color represent the addresses of nodes. Web2 jun. 2024 · Next up, we will implement four helper methods for the linked list. They are: size () clear () getLast () getFirst () 1. size () This method returns the number of nodes … grape fire red 5 https://mgcidaho.com

How to Reverse a Linked List in JavaScript - Medium

WebLinked List in JavaScript: How to Create Circular and Reversed Lists by Elson Correia Before Semicolon Medium 500 Apologies, but something went wrong on our end. Refresh the page,... Web22 sep. 2012 · You can do it like this (in plain javascript). You can just cycle through the li tags in reverse order and append them to the parent. This will have the natural effect of reversing their order. You get the last one, append it to the end of the list, get the 2nd to last one, append it to the list. grape flatware

JavaScript: Reverse a Linked List - Will Vincent

Category:Javascript Program For Printing Reverse Of A Linked List …

Tags:How to reverse linked list in javascript

How to reverse linked list in javascript

REVERSE A SINGLY LINKED LIST USING JAVASCRIPT

Web18 okt. 2024 · Reversing a Linked List Visualization of reversing a linked list from the author — Created using paint node* reverse (node* &head) { node*prevptr=NULL; node*currptr=head; node*nextptr; while (currptr!=NULL) { nextptr=currptr->next; currptr->next=prevptr; prevptr=currptr; currptr=nextptr; } return prevptr; } WebNew Post: UUID as Entity ID in MongoDB. Single Assert Call for Multiple Properties in Java Unit Testing Baeldung

How to reverse linked list in javascript

Did you know?

Web20 sep. 2024 · Method 2: Reverse the doubly linked list by swapping the nodes. In this method we will swap the nodes by exchanging them, Like removing the first node from the head and adding as the last node to the new list. As we will repeat this for all the node of the list, thus the new list which will be formed will be in the reverse order. Web10 aug. 2024 · Recursive solution: I will use the linked list below for explaining this solution: 1 -> 2 -> 3 -> 4 ->null. The first call will be from the main method and it will pass in …

Web11 okt. 2024 · Here is a common JavaScript interview question: Reverse a singly linked list. Do it in-place. The function should take one input (head of the list) and return the … Web11 nov. 2024 · In this iterative algorithm, we first set the pointer as a pointer and the as the . Then, in each iteration of the loop, we reverse the linked pointer of these two elements and shift the and pointers to the next two elements. In the end, the pointer will point to the new head element of the reversed linked list.

Web22 nov. 2024 · Generally speaking, to reverse a linked list, you can do this in recursion or iteratively. Recursively Reverse a Linked List. To solve this problem recursively, we … Web18 okt. 2024 · Set current.next equal to prev (we can now change next of current by reversing the link). Set prev to current (this step moves the previous node forward). Set …

Web14 mei 2024 · Traverse the linked list from start to end copy the elements into an array, after completing the traversal print elements of the array in reverse order. …

Web16 dec. 2024 · While reversing keep track of the next node and previous node. Let the pointer to the next node be next and pointer to the previous node be prev. See this post … chippewa county wisconsin plat bookWeb12 jul. 2024 · An algorithm for sorting a linked list in javascript. We will implement the insertion sort algorithm with linked list to sort the list in ascending or descending order. Example Input: 10 -> 5 -> 22 -> 3 -> 17 -> 10 Output: 3 -> 5 -> 10 -> 10 -> 17 -> 22 Implementation for sorting a linked list We will use a temporary node to sort the linked … chippewa county wisconsin covid 19Web11 nov. 2024 · 3. Iterative Solution. Firstly, let’s solve a simpler version of the problem: reverse a linked list with two elements: Suppose the pointer points to the second … grape flavored chipsWeb13 okt.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. grape flavored cake recipeWebHow to reverse a linked list in Hindi. You can Beat the competitive programming through JavaScript. Leetcode, hackerrank and geeks for geeks solution for rev... chippewa county wisconsin mapWeb8 jun. 2024 · The recursive approach to reverse a linked list is simple, just we have to divide the linked lists in two parts and i.e first node and the rest of the linked list, and then call the recursion for the other part by maintaining the connection. Recursive Approach Implementation Of Recursive Approach C++ Implementation chippewa county wisconsin property taxWeb22 apr. 2024 · Traverse the linked list to find the last node (tail). tail.next = newNode; Inserting a node at given random position in a singly linked list To implement this operation we will have to traverse the list until we reach the desired position node. We will then assign the newNode’s next pointer to the next node to the position node. grape flavored creatine